#02119f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#02119f is composed of 0.8% red, 6.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 89.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 31.6%. #02119f color hex could be obtained by blending #0422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#02119f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#02119f has RGB values of R:2, G:17,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 135583.

Shades and Tints of #02119f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000004 is the darkest color, while #f0f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#02119f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4d55 is the less saturated color, while #02119f is the most saturated one.
